Our Speaker
As the leader of a more than $5 million natural, gourmet baking company, Trish Karter, Chief Executive Officer and President of Dancing Deer Baking Co., marries her creative, artistic, environmental, community and business interests. The woman-owned enterprise in Boston's inner city is lauded as one of the nation's most innovative natural food companies as Dancing Deer products have been featured in Time Magazine, Good Housekeeping and the Boston Herald.
A true corporate citizen, Dancing Deer partners in a charitable venture Sweet Home Project with the Paul and Phyllis Fireman Foundation. Dancing Deer donates 35 percent of the retail price from the sale of Sweet Home products to direct action programs to end family homelessness.
Karter received a master's degree in public and private management from Yale. In 2005, Fortune Small Business magazine recognized her as a "Best Boss" and Women's Business Enterprise National Council (WBENC) as a "Women Owned Business Star."
